Farsoon FS200M-2 Metal System Showcase

    Introducing FS200M-2 System
    As a new addition to our medium-sized metal LPBF portfolio, the FS200M-2 is equipped with a versatile build volume of 425 x 230 x 300 mm and powerful dual 500-watt laser configuration. The FS200M-2 is ideal for medium to high volume metal series production and prototypes with fast manufacturing turn-overs rates, versatility, and impressive ROI.

    Industrial Applications with FS200M-2
    Farsoon’s FS200M-2 is a high-value proposition metal system in pursuit of productivity, cost-efficiency and ease of use for a wide range of industrial applications. The rectangular build chamber is well suited for fabrication of large parts which favor one axis, such as applications in aerospace, automotive and tooling.

    Shoe Mold
    Machine: FS200M-2
    Material: Aluminum
    Size: 332 x 138 x 66 (H) mm each
    Build Time: 17 Hours

    Targeting a series of challenges in traditional shoe sole manufacturing including frequent design updates, low volume customization, and complexity of the pattern, many shoe manufacturers has adopted 3D Printing technology for direct production of end-use shoe sole molds. Rapidly produced on Farsoon’s FS200M dual laser system in only 17 hours, the shoe sole mold has achieved significantly shorter lead time compared to traditional manufacturing. The as-printed part is able to achieve a high surface quality which only need minimum post-processing such as bead blasting before used for injection molding.

    FARSOON FS200M-2 TECHNICAL DATA
    External Dimension(L×W×H) 2320×1500×2000 mm (91.3×59.1×78.7 in)
    Build Cylinder Size(1 L×W×H) 425×230×300 mm ( 16.7×9.1×11.8 in ) (not including build plate thickness)
    Net Weight Approx. 2000 kg (4409.2 lb
    Layer Thickness 0.02~0.1 mm ( 0.0008-0.0039 in )
    Scanning Speed2 Max. 10 m/s ( 32.8 ft/s )
    Laser Type Dual fiber lasers, 2×500W
    Scanner F theta lenses
    Inert Gas Protection Argon/Nitrogen
    Average Inert Gas Consumption in Process 3-5 L / min
    Operating System 64 bit Windows 10
    Comprehensive Software BuildStar, MakeStar®
    Key Software Features Open machine key parameters, real-time build parameter modification, three-dimensional
    visualization, diagnostic functions, automatic grafting alignment option available
    Data File Format STL
    Power Supply EUR/China: 400V±10%, 3~/N/PE, 50Hz, 25A US: transformer sold with machine
    Operating Ambient Temperature 22-28°C ( 71.6-82.4℉ )
    Materials3 316L, AlSi10Mg, ST1*, Maraging Steel Grade 300*, 420*, more materials to come
